Versus Systems Company Profile
Versus Systems is a technology company that specializes in digital engagement and incentivization solutions for brands, publishers and game developers. Its core offering is the Versus platform, which allows companies to integrate branded challenges and rewards directly into digital experiences such as video games, streaming content and e-commerce sites. By embedding real-time incentives—ranging from digital collectibles and in-game items to discount codes and promotional offers—Versus aims to enhance user engagement and drive brand affinity through interactive, gamified mechanics.
The company’s technology leverages blockchain and web3 principles to deliver verifiable, traceable rewards while supporting traditional digital asset distribution.
